The time scale of impacts on society in areas which <strong>BALTEX</strong> is addressing may be in the order of<br />
decades or beyond, <strong>and</strong> awareness in the public is particularly needed in the context of sustainability.<br />
Reaching in particular the youth is thus seen as an important aspect. The <strong>BALTEX</strong> programme will<br />
help to prepare school courses including practical laboratory experimental <strong>and</strong> theoretical lectures in<br />
collaboration with teachers, who will specify the level of contents <strong>and</strong> presentation measures to adapt<br />
to the experience level of the youth. Involvement in school programmes may serve as a multiplier for<br />
the general public, as not only pupils themselves but also their parents will be reached by the<br />
programme.<br />
Current research topics of the <strong>BALTEX</strong> programme including up-to-date research questions <strong>and</strong><br />
results will be offered to existing pupil laboratories or pupil courses Activities in this field will have a<br />
pilot character, in the sense that few specific schools will be contacted in order to establish an<br />
education programme jointly with scientists <strong>and</strong> teachers. A collaboration with already existing<br />
projects like “CarboSchools” (www.carboschools.org) <strong>and</strong> the NaT-Working project of the Leibnitz<br />
Institute for Marine Research in Kiel, Germany (nat-meer.ifm-geomar.de), as well with ongoing<br />
projects in all <strong>BALTEX</strong> countries is envisaged.<br />
Awareness creation in the context of sustainability is only one aspect of reaching the youth. Another<br />
one is creating interest, already at pupils’ age, in a later professional carrier as a researcher in the<br />
scientific fields which <strong>BALTEX</strong> is addressing. Dedicated education <strong>and</strong> awareness creation is seen as<br />
one measure to reverse the present general trend of decreasing numbers of students in particular in<br />
geophysical sciences in many European countries in recent years. The organisation of “Open Days” in<br />
research institutes involved in <strong>BALTEX</strong> research will be a further important activity to reach the<br />
public.<br />
6.5. Implementation of Education <strong>and</strong> Outreach<br />
The specific activities under this section of the programme, necessary for improving the outreach of<br />
<strong>BALTEX</strong>, are naturally diverse in their form <strong>and</strong> frequency of implementation. They need to be<br />
implemented in such a way as to ensure coordination across the various scientific topics of the<br />
programme <strong>and</strong> target sectors of the society to be addressed. Coordination of these activities is<br />
envisaged to be assured through implementation of a specific <strong>BALTEX</strong> Working Group on Public<br />
Relation. Nevertheless, to carry out all envisaged education <strong>and</strong> outreach activities, funding for the<br />
scientific work together with these elements is indispensable.
